MUFG seeks an experienced HR Business Partner to drive people strategy across MUFG Bank and MUFG Securities EMEA plc. The VP will partner with senior stakeholders, deliver HR solutions, drive strategic initiatives, and ensure regulatory compliance in a supportive and inclusive environment.
Responsibilities
- Partner with business areas to align HR practices with strategic initiatives, attend planning meetings and provide comprehensive advice.
- Design and lead strategic projects that drive business results in line with the Medium‑Term Business Plan, ensuring HR services are proactive, commercial and responsive.
- Diagnose business issues and goals effectively, aligning them with the People Strategy to nurture a high‑performance culture.
- Develop strong relationships with Centres of Excellence (CoEs) and HR peers regionally and globally, acting as subject matter expert for allocated CoE partnerships.
- Collaborate with managers to develop, implement, and manage career development plans.
- Support line management in forecasting and planning talent requirements in accordance with evolving business strategies.
- Oversee the Compensation Review process, working with Reward, Regulation & Benefits teams to ensure fairness and market competitiveness.
- Address complex queries related to compensation surveys, expatriation issues, flexible benefits, tax matters and other associated topics.
- Ensure performance management policies are implemented consistently and lead or contribute to departmental or cross‑business projects.
- Manage Employee Relations cases including investigations, grievances, disciplinary processes, appeals and dispute resolution in accordance with legal requirements and company policy.
